(KNZA)--An Atchison woman was injured in a two-vehicle crash late Friday afternoon in Shawnee County.
The Kansas Highway Patrol says it happened at the intersection of K-4 and U.S. 24 Highways around 4:50.
According to the KHP report, a Ford Edge driven by 45-year-old Joshua Pittman, of Topeka, was westbound on the U.S. 24 off ramp to K-4 and failed to stop at the stop sign. Pittman pulled out in front of northbound Jeep Liberty on K-4 and was struck by the vehicle.
The driver of Liberty, 46-year-old Stephanie Barnes, of Atchison, was transported to a Topeka Hospital with suspected minor injuries.
Pittman was not hurt.
The Patrol says both drivers, who were alone in their vehicles, were buckled up when the wreck occurred.
